Emerging Microwave Technologies to Watch in 2025

Looking ahead to 2025, it seems like the microwave world is about to get a serious upgrade. We’re talking about some pretty cool advances that will make your cooking easier and more energy-friendly. One of the biggest trends? smart technology! Imagine controlling your microwave from your phone—preheating it before you even get home or getting a heads-up when your food’s done. Honestly, it’s kind of a game changer for busy folks who want convenience without the hassle.

**Pro tip:** When shopping for a new microwave, try to find one that’s Wi-Fi-enabled and works with your smart home setup. It’ll make sure you’re keeping up with the latest tech trends, no sweat.

Another exciting development is sensor cooking tech. These microwaves can automatically adjust cooking times based on how moist or hot your food is. That means your meals come out just right, without the risk of overcooking—super handy, right?

**Another tip:** Look for models with built-in sensors. They’ll give you consistent results and save you some time and effort in the kitchen—no more guesswork needed.

Integrating Smart Features: The Future of Microwave User Experience

As microwave tech keeps evolving, it’s pretty clear that adding smart features has become essential if brands want to really boost the user experience. I mean, a report from MarketsandMarkets points out that the market for smart kitchen gadgets is expected to jump from around $200 billion back in 2020 to a whopping $400 billion by 2025. That’s a pretty solid sign that people are super interested in intelligent home devices right now. It basically pushes microwave makers to jump on the bandwagon and bring in the latest tech to make their products more functional and engaging.

Things like voice control, app-connected features, and automatic cooking settings totally change how we interact with our microwaves. A survey by Statista found that about 67% of folks are into the idea of controlling their kitchen gadgets remotely through smartphone apps. When manufacturers add these kinds of features, it doesn’t just meet what consumers want — it also makes kitchen work feel smoother and helps us cook better. Plus, smart sensors can really help fine-tune the cooking process, making sure food is cooked just right every time. All in all, these upgrades turn your microwave from just a basic heat-up machine into a real handy culinary buddy.

Navigating Regulatory Standards for Global Microwave Design

Navigating the complicated world of regulations for microwave ovens is more important than ever, especially with all the exciting tech advancements we expect by 2025. I mean, the industry’s changing fast, and manufacturers need to keep up. You’ll want to make sure your designs line up with international standards like IEC 60705, which covers microwave power testing, and UL 923, the go-to for safety and performance. According to a recent report from Global Market Insights, the microwave market is set to top $30 billion by 2025. That means staying compliant isn’t just about following rules — it’s a smart move to stay competitive.
